Abstract
A control method for the angle servo of reference beam during reading recoded data images of a holographic data storage system is presented. The recording scheme with track offset is adopted in order to verify the proposed angle servo. Using only recorded data tracks the angle error signal of reference beam is generated and the angle servo is implemented. Experiments have been performed on recording and reading data images to compensate Bragg angle mismatch.
